About Ranikhet Disease:
- Also known as: Newcastle Disease (ND)
- Causative Agent: Avian avulavirus 1 (also called Avian Paramyxovirus-1 or APMV-1)
- Affected Species: Primarily chickens, but also turkeys, ducks, pigeons, crows, geese, guinea fowls, partridges, doves, and even hedgehogs (suspected reservoirs).
- Nature of Disease: Highly contagious and fatal viral disease.
- Transmission:
- Direct contact with infected bird secretions (especially feces)
- Contaminated feed, water, equipment, clothing, and environment
- ND virus can survive for weeks in cool environments, increasing risk in winter.
Symptoms and Impact:
- In Birds:
- Respiratory issues: Sneezing, gasping
- Nervous symptoms: Droopiness, loss of coordination
- Digestive symptoms: Diarrhea
- Mortality rate: Ranges from 50% to 100%
- Production impact: Drop in egg production and fertility
- In Humans:
- Mild zoonotic effect, primarily conjunctivitis in people handling infected birds or lab samples.
- Usually self-limiting and non-fatal.
Recent Outbreaks and Investigations:
Andhra Pradesh:
- Approximately 1.5 lakh birds have died across multiple districts.
- Suspected cause: Highly virulent strain of Ranikhet Disease.
Haryana (Barwala–Raipur Rani belt):
- This belt houses around 115 poultry farms and is the second-largest poultry producer in Asia.
- Previously affected by bird flu outbreaks in 2006 and 2014.
- Northern Regional Disease Diagnostic Laboratory (NRDDL), Jalandhar collected 40 new samples from affected farms after being unsatisfied with earlier ones.
- Preliminary suspicion points toward Ranikhet Disease; however, cold wave conditions and the presence of older birds (not replaced due to COVID-19 restrictions) may have also contributed.
- The region falls in the path of migratory birds, whose droppings can spread avian flu viruses, complicating disease identification.
Current Challenges:
- Lack of effective treatment: No curative treatment exists. Management relies on preventive vaccination, biosecurity measures, and good poultry housing practices.
- Diagnostic delays: Require reliable sampling and laboratory testing to confirm the cause.
- Climate sensitivity: Poultry are vulnerable to extreme cold, especially if housing and care are inadequate.
- Pandemic aftershocks: COVID-19 disruptions prevented the routine replacement of older birds, increasing vulnerability.
